The king sighed and, after a short moment of thought, began to speak again: “Let’s assume I believe you, and this is in fact so advantageous. What are the disadvantages? And do not try to tell me there are none, because there always are some. They might be less than the advantages, especially under certain circumstances, but there will be some. So answer me!”
At the end, the king got very loud.
Jonathan thought for a moment and then began to answer carefully: “A democracy means that the old elite will loose at least some power and privileges. If they are intelligent they just might loose the privileges, and could hang on to their power pretty well, but over time it is almost guaranteed that others will gain power, at a cost to those old elites, of which you personally are a part of. So those might make problems, which could end in a civil war, which would be problematic, especially if most of the mages take the side of the old power, fearing for their own positions. Still, if implemented carefully, this might not necessarily happen. Outside powers are of course a problem as well, a democracy directly at their borders might set an unwanted precedent. But one of the biggest problems that democracies tend to have is their readiness to go to war. Because of this and because the leaders of a democracy need to conform to the wishes of the people in at least some capacity, democracies do not tend to have a large standing army, especially if there is not an active threat. Do not make the mistake of assuming them to be militarily weak because of that, they can easily have their people’s trained and the arms stored away. Their active forces are always only meant to hold until the reserve can be activated. And, while the reserve of this country right now consists of even more untrained levies, the reserve of a democracy consists of people who are well trained, and, to top it all of, also get a small refresher if the situation permits it. In fact, in most modern democracies, there are two types of reserve forces. The official reserve forces, who are regularly trained and are part of existing units, even if they might consist completely out of members of the reserve, which can thus be activated very quickly, and persons who already went through basic training of some form, maybe as part of a short mandatory training period and then go one with their lives as normal. Even though, in my era, especially the latter kind looses importance, because of the threat of weapons, which can destroy the world. If you are forced to call those units up, the situation might already be hopeless, so why not go out in a bang and hope that death will be painless?”
Advertisement
The king nodded to that.
Not necessarily what he would have thought, but still not necessarily stupid. Humans were egoistical beings.
He thought for a moment and then answered: “You want this. I understand, you have never known something else, and you think that monarchies are something that did not work particularly well. And when I look at how my nobles behave, then I understand that sentiment. But still, even though I should be against democracies, I see no other choice but to begin that process. We need to begin to plan how exactly it will look like, and I will, of course try to keep as much power in my hands as possible, but I want to enact at least some reforms!”
